Bold Color Takes Center Court
Spring 2026 tennis apparel embraces vibrant, high-energy colors. Expect to see shades like coral, neon green, lavender, sapphire, and bright pink dominating the court.
Color-blocking and gradient “fade” designs are trending—even among classic brands—adding visual interest while maintaining a clean tennis aesthetic.
Softer tones like pastel blues, pale greys, and petal-inspired hues balance the boldness, making outfits both modern and wearable.

Performance Meets Lifestyle
Tennis apparel is no longer limited to match play. Today’s designs blend performance with lifestyle wear, making it easy to transition from the court to everyday activities.
Key features include:
- Lightweight, breathable fabrics
- Moisture-wicking technology
- Stretch materials for full mobility
- Versatile styles for casual wear
This crossover trend reflects the rise of athleisure, where tennis fashion becomes part of everyday style.

Sustainable & Technical Fabrics
Sustainability continues to shape tennis apparel. Many Spring 2026 collections incorporate recycled materials while maintaining elite performance standards.
Brands like adidas and Babolat are also introducing “technical elegance”—fabrics that feel soft like cotton but perform like high-performance athletic gear.

What’s Staying in Style (With a Twist)
Classic tennis staples are evolving rather than disappearing. The traditional tennis polo remains essential but now features slimmer fits, updated collars, and subtle textures.
Tennis dresses and skirts are also being refreshed with geometric designs, higher waistlines, and asymmetrical hems—offering a modern edge while keeping their iconic appeal.
These updates maintain a clean, confident look that works both on and off the court.
